V najjednoduchšej forme je jednoducho prepojený zoznam prepojený zoznam, kde každý uzol predstavuje objekt, v ktorom je uložený odkaz na prvok a odkaz, ktorý sa volá next, na iný uzol. … Koncový uzol je špeciálny uzol, kde nasledujúci ukazovateľ vždy ukazuje alebo odkazuje na nulový odkaz, čo označuje koniec zoznamu.
Môžeme použiť koncový ukazovateľ pre jednotlivo prepojený zoznam?
V skutočnosti môžete implementovať enqueue (priložiť na koniec), zatlačiť (predložiť na hlavu), vyradiť z fronty (odstrániť z hlavy) a samozrejme nájsť a vytlačiť pomocou hlavička s jedným ukazovateľom. Trik je v tom, aby bol zoznam kruhový a hlavička smerovala na koniec. Potom chvost->nasleduje hlava.
Má zoznam s dvojitým odkazom koniec?
Podobne ako v jednoducho prepojenom zozname, aj dvojito prepojený zoznam má hlavu a koniec. Predchádzajúci ukazovateľ hlavy je nastavený na hodnotu NULL, pretože toto je prvý uzol.
Má prepojený zoznam Java koniec?
Prepojený zoznam obsahuje kolekciu uzlov. … Posledný uzol v zozname sa nazýva chvost a jeho ukazovateľ na nasledujúci uzol ukazuje na hodnotu null. Takto vyzerá dvojito prepojený zoznam: V jazyku Java už existuje implementácia prepojeného zoznamu – java.
Čo je pravda o jednotlivo prepojenom zozname?
Jednoducho prepojený zoznam je typ prepojeného zoznamu, ktorý je jednosmerný, to znamená, že ho možno prechádzať iba jedným smerom od hlavy po posledný uzol (koniec). … Prvý uzol sa nazýva hlava; ukazuje na prvý uzol zoznamu a pomáha nám získať prístup ku každému ďalšiemu prvku v zozname.